The first step in a birth injury lawsuit is to look over the medical documents of the pregnancy, delivery and labor. This will allow the attorney to determine whether there is evidence of medical malpractice. The lawyer will speak with medical experts to review the case and provide an official opinion on whether the doctor's actions were in violation of the standards of care.

After the lawyer has received the opinion of the medical experts they will be able to demonstrate that the injury to the mother and/or baby was caused by a doctor's negligence. The next step is to demonstrate that the injury resulted in tangible damages such as medical expenses as well as lost wages due to missing work, future treatment costs therapy and counseling expenses as well as disability accommodations, emotional distress and more.

Premature birth

About 1 in 10 babies are born prematurely, or before the 37th week of pregnancy. If a baby is born before full-term the health of the infant is at risk for the rest of their lives.

Certain medical conditions increase the likelihood of preterm births for example, infections in the mother or complications resulting from multiple births. Doctors can usually avoid premature birth by observing the health of the mother and responding to any signs that the pregnancy isn't going according to plan.

Medical negligence during birth can have both short-term and longer-term consequences for the mother and child. The short-term consequences can include physical, psychological and neurological issues that could impact the development of a child. Long-term effects include cerebral palsy and developmental delays.

Infants born too early may have difficulty breathing because their lungs aren't fully developed. They could also experience brain damage since their brains are young and cannot process oxygen properly.

While premature birth is a frequent problem however, it can be prevented with proper prenatal care and monitoring. Doctors should recognize any signs of a preterm labor and give birth to the mother before the risk of complications increases. Medical malpractice and birth injuries can result if this is not done.
